Hello Everyone! I hope everyone is doing well, and checking their blood sugars regularly. Today I went to our State Capitol in Frankfort, KY to participate in our Diabetes Day at the Capitol. Diabetes Day at the Capitol is an event that brings over 100 people to the State Capitol to talk with their legislators about any bills that are trying to get passed, or just simply to tell their story to their legislator. Usually they would rather want to hear your story instead of what you are supposed to talk them about.

Starting in the morning, we were in a Committee Room where we talked about what we were going to do that day such as the main topic of the Diabetes Day at the Capitol, what to talk to your senators/representatives about, and the agenda for the day. After we did that, we all moved to the Rotunda of the Capitol Building. There were lots of chairs all surrounding the pulpit at the front of the Rotunda. First, we had the president of the KDN (Kentucky Diabetes Network), Larry Steele speak, then Vice Chair Elect of the Board of ADA, Stewart Perry, following with me introducing Chief of Staff to Governor Ernie Fletcher, Stan Cave, then Stan Cave, along with Secretary of Health Mark Birdwhistell, and the Speaker of the House, Jody Richards. This was a great even that we had in the Rotunda, and I am glad that it all went smoothly.

After the session ended in the Rotunda, we were released and sent to go talk to our legislators. They didn’t have set the meetings up for you; you were just supposed to do it on your own. So I did that, and I met with two Representatives, and Secretary of Health, Mark Birdwhistell. The Secretary is a great man, and he is really concerned about the lives of others with health issues, specifically diabetes. I am glad that we have a man like him in our government.

After looking back on the day, it went great. We had a record number of people there, 128, and I am positively reassured that everyone got to their Senator/Representative. Thank you everyone!!
